
SpringBoot快速入门
文章平均质量分 80
SpringBoot快速入门,整合ftl模板引擎,整合jdbc,mybatis,devtools,logback,定时任务,线程池,打包发布
无休止符
不要让任何事情,成为你不去学习的理由!!!
展开
-
九、SpringBoot项目打包部署与全局异常捕获
目录一、全局异常捕获二、SpringBoot项目打包 一、全局异常捕获 1.全局异常捕获注解 @ExceptionHandler 表示拦截异常 @ControllerAdvice 是 controller 的一个辅助类,最常用的就是作为全局异常处理的切面类 @ControllerAdvice 可以指定扫描范围 @ControllerAdvice 约定了几种可行的返回值 如果是直接返回 model 类的话,需要使用 @ResponseBody 进行 json 转换 返回 String,表示跳到某个 vi原创 2022-03-23 22:32:15 · 621 阅读 · 0 评论 -
八、SpringBoot整合多线程异步
目录前言一、异步调用实现二、@Async整合线程池 前言 @Async实际就是多线程封装的 异步线程执行方法有可能会非常消耗cpu的资源,所以大的项目建议使用Mq异步实现 一、异步调用实现 1.启动类需要添加注解@EnableAsync @SpringBootApplication @EnableAsync public class App { public static void main(String[] args) { SpringApplication.run(App原创 2022-03-23 21:19:38 · 1051 阅读 · 0 评论 -
七、SpringBoot整合定时任务
目录一、使用SpringBoot创建定时任务二、定时任务使用Quartz表达式 一、使用SpringBoot创建定时任务 1.pom spring默认就集成了定时任务,不需要单独再引入依赖 2.启动类增加注解@EnableScheduling @SpringBootApplication @EnableScheduling public class App { public static void main(String[] args) { SpringApplicatio原创 2022-03-23 18:50:03 · 821 阅读 · 0 评论 -
六、SpringBoot整合日志log
目录原创 2022-03-23 16:55:26 · 1715 阅读 · 0 评论 -
五、SpringBoot整合配置文件
目录一、SpringBoot读取配置文件二、@ConfigurationProperties三、文件占位符随机数四、SpringBoot多环境配置五、SpringBoot配置端口号和上下文访问路径 一、SpringBoot读取配置文件 1.SpringBoot配置文件分类 a)application.properties或者Bootstrap.properties b)application.yml或者Bootstrap.yml(我们更推荐使用yml格式的配置文件) 2.加载顺序 bootstra原创 2022-03-22 22:20:17 · 1254 阅读 · 0 评论 -
四、SpringBoot整合热部署devtools及lombok
目录原创 2022-03-22 21:34:09 · 266 阅读 · 0 评论 -
三、SpringBoot整合数据库访问层
目录一、springboot整合使用JdbcTemplate二、整合mybatis框架查询三、整合mybatis框架插入 一、springboot整合使用JdbcTemplate 1.pom依赖 <!--SpringBoot整合jdbc模板框架--> <dependency> <groupId>org.springframework.boot</groupId> <art原创 2022-03-22 18:04:21 · 1200 阅读 · 0 评论 -
二、SpringBoot整合Web开发
目录一、SpringBoot整合静态资源访问二、yml与properties配置三、SpringBoot渲染Web页面四、SpringBoot整合Freemarker五、ftl模板引擎条件判断用法 一、SpringBoot整合静态资源访问 1.SpringBoot默认配置 Spring Boot默认提供静态资源目录位置需置于classpath下,目录名需符合如下规则: /static、/public、/resources、/META-INF/resources 2.案例 我们可以在src/m原创 2022-03-22 14:42:36 · 777 阅读 · 2 评论 -
一、SpringBoot快速入门
目录一、SpringBoot简介二、SpringBoot项目构建三、SpringBoot依赖引入介绍四、`@RestController`注解五、SpringBoot启动方式1、`@EnableAutoConfiguration`2、`@ComponentScan`3、`@SpringBootApplication` 一、SpringBoot简介 1.什么是SpringBoot SpringBoot 是一个快速开发的框架, 封装了Maven常用依赖、能够快速的整合第三方框架;简化XML配置,全部采用注解原创 2022-03-22 10:37:44 · 359 阅读 · 0 评论